    I am now the owner of a 2006 Grand Prix GT Upgrading to this from a 99 grand am is pretty awesome. It's got 60k on it, and drives fantastic. The only issue I'm having now is it needs a new tensioner pulley, it squeels on cold start up and then goes away once the engine is warmed up. Besides that, it's a great car and I'm absolutely loving it so far.
